One way to add a personal touch to your home décor is to add your favorite quote over your half wall ledge. This can be a great way to show off your unique personality and make your space feel more inviting.

There are a few things to keep in mind when choosing a quote for this project. First, make sure that the quote is shorter than the width of the ledge. Second, choose a font that is easy to read from a distance. Third, consider the overall contrast of the quote against the wall color.

If you’re looking for a way to add some extra light and interest to your half wall ledge, consider adding LED lights. LED lights are relatively inexpensive, easy to install, and can provide a subtle but effective way to highlight items on your ledge.

You can find LED lights in a variety of colors, so you can choose the perfect shade to complement your decor. Plus, LED lights use very little electricity, so you’ll save money on your energy bill while still enjoying the benefits of beautiful lighting.
